Only half of Europeans say they work in psychologically healthy workplaces

Workplace Insight

Only a little over half of employees across Europe believe they work in psychologically healthy workplaces, according to a new poll from Great Place To Work [registration]. The research, which surveyed nearly 25,000 employees across 19 countries, highlights significant disparities between industries and regions, with the UK falling slightly below the European average.

Canada Records Jobs Decline For First Time Since 2022

Allwork

Canada’s total employment fell and the unemployment rate ticked up in March, data showed on Friday, as the uncertainty around tariffs and their subsequent implementation forced companies to pause hiring and spurred some layoffs. The country shed a net 32,600 jobs last month, the first decrease in more than three years. It was driven by a steep decline in full-time work, Statistics Canada said.
